About the role

  • Planning
  • Assign personnel to workstations and tasks according to department needs (continuous improvement, training, etc.), including managing shift rotation
  • Monitor the execution of planned activities and ensure information exchange between team members and the department
  • Perform regular checks on adherence to the schedule and implement corrective actions in case of deviations
  • Performance management
  • Define KPIs (key performance indicators) and operational objectives
  • Monitor the department’s objectives, assignments and deliverables on a daily basis, ensuring they are met on time, within cost, quality, safety and required quantity
  • Monitor performance against the department’s key indicators (productivity, quality, lead time, etc.) and report performance deviations
  • Ensure the department’s deliverables comply with applicable regulations (GMP, labor regulations, corporate guidelines, ISO, etc.)
  • Analyze and implement an organization to resolve quality, safety and performance gaps in the service
  • Be responsible for the continuous improvement process and its implementation
  • Lead problem resolution for relevant department activities (clarification, control of deviations)
  • Coaching / Process confirmation
  • Define the short-term strategy of the department in line with the overall objectives
  • Set objectives for team members and operational KPIs according to department strategy
  • Ensure work standards are respected and carry out process confirmations
  • Coach and develop team members’ skills
  • Challenge inappropriate behavior and apply disciplinary policy when necessary
  • Team management
  • Assess competencies, identify and manage training needs for team members
  • Share the department’s direction and strategy to ensure team engagement
  • Ensure recruitment of team members
  • Monitor individual development progress and provide feedback on performance
  • Monitor and resolve issues related to team members’ quality of work life
  • Carry out administrative tasks related to people management.
